Output 40c755dc9c764c35f5e4380a2c4824fa01492123edbc0a1260dd80350e4176a9:4

value
86971420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f88649a0e42897ceb17131344d080bfdeeb12107 OP_EQUAL
address
3QM6NarX1V3wr596SvZ2VKNLqJCYCyybU4
transaction
40c755dc9c764c35f5e4380a2c4824fa01492123edbc0a1260dd80350e4176a9
spent
true